
Columbia Gorge Regional Airport
Gateway to the Columbia River Gorge in the Pacific Northwest.
- ›Located in Dallesport, Washington, directly across the Columbia River from The Dalles, Oregon.
- ›Owned and operated by Klickitat County, Washington.
- ›The airport sits at an elevation of approximately 247 feet above mean sea level.
- ›Primarily serves general aviation, charter, and agricultural aviation operations.
- ›Situated within the scenic Columbia River Gorge National Scenic Area.

Columbia Gorge Regional Airport, also referred to as The Dalles Municipal Airport, is a public use airport in Klickitat County in the U.S. state of Washington. It is located near Dallesport, Washington and two nautical miles (4 km) northeast of the city of The Dalles in the state of Oregon. This airport is included in the National Plan of Integrated Airport Systems for 2011–2015, which categorized it as a general aviation facility.
